Transaction 1ef73a4ccf64bbcbff94b16c0b023ccabd7e194180d4402533af093225a73b3f

1 Input
2 Outputs
  • 1ef73a4ccf64bbcbff94b16c0b023ccabd7e194180d4402533af093225a73b3f:0
  • value  3686599
    address  1FeDFphsPgd7va7T5ResgGJggunPQTnBcZ
  • 1ef73a4ccf64bbcbff94b16c0b023ccabd7e194180d4402533af093225a73b3f:1
  • value  100546738
    address  149DDBwYgXWPaUKxjFEx94xJJDPWRw65jB